Transaction 34cb7b0e95fef9f5a92d91f237923d63ee7b20cf7507e20a202656f736e12b8e

1 Input
2 Outputs
  • 34cb7b0e95fef9f5a92d91f237923d63ee7b20cf7507e20a202656f736e12b8e:0
  • value  49992543
    address  3DyxUWWA9esLwL5xv3DnbSUADBStRATb1j
  • 34cb7b0e95fef9f5a92d91f237923d63ee7b20cf7507e20a202656f736e12b8e:1
  • value  50000000
    address  3A9iGHnAqZwrC5P9GTv2mRA5JhF1V2yTqi